Leveraging its multi-disciplinary team of specialists, FS Engineering develops advanced solutions for railway Central Control Centres. These systems are purpose-built for the comprehensive command and supervision of rail operations, with particular emphasis on routes equipped with computer-based interlocking (ACCM) and ERTMS frameworks. Operational control is delivered via modern, centralised traffic management systems (SCCM) that integrate advanced rail traffic regulation functions with intelligent system diagnostics and condition monitoring. This capabilities matrix enables the early detection of faults and infrastructure anomalies, directly underpinning exceptional standards of network reliability, operational safety, and service continuity.

For power supply networks and life-safety systems in tunnels and stations, FS Engineering designs and implements centralised remote control platforms. These systems enable the comprehensive command and supervision of electric traction infrastructure alongside the core mechanical and electrical (M&E) systems.
Through these centralised remote control architectures, all plant and equipment within traction substations, along the overhead line equipment (OLE), and across critical sections of the electrical installation are controlled and monitored within a single, integrated framework.
These supervisory systems enable real-time remote configuration and control of lineside networks. This ensures absolute operational continuity even during system faults or structural anomalies, while facilitating the continuous monitoring of critical electrical parameters, including line voltage and current.
